General Hospital spoiler: A Loving Montage for Anthony Geary as Tristan Rogers’ Scorpio Finally Gets a Proper Send-Off

General Hospital is once again turning its attention to legacy, history, and gratitude as plans move forward to honor two of its most iconic figures: Anthony Geary and Tristan Rogers. For longtime fans, this upcoming tribute isn’t just another episode—it’s a meaningful celebration of the men who helped define the heart and soul of Port Charles for generations.

At the center of the tribute is a loving montage dedicated to Anthony Geary, the legendary actor behind Luke Spencer. The montage is expected to revisit defining moments from Luke’s decades-long journey—capturing his complexity, contradictions, and emotional depth.

Rather than focusing solely on spectacle, the tribute is designed to reflect the humanity Geary brought to the role, honoring both the character and the artist who shaped him.

Luke Spencer wasn’t just a fan favorite; he was a cultural force. His presence reshaped storytelling on General Hospital, pushing the show toward bolder, more emotionally layered narratives.

The montage is said to highlight that impact, reminding viewers why Luke remains one of the most influential characters in daytime television history. For many fans, it will feel like a final, respectful bow—one rooted in gratitude rather than goodbye.

Alongside the tribute to Geary, General Hospital is also preparing a proper send-off for Tristan Rogers’ Robert Scorpio, something fans have been asking for years. Scorpio, a cornerstone of the show’s spy-era storytelling, has often come and gone without the closure his legacy deserves. This time, the writers appear determined to change that.

Robert Scorpio’s farewell is expected to honor the character’s intelligence, bravery, and emotional restraint—the qualities that made him unforgettable.

Rather than a quiet exit, this send-off aims to acknowledge Scorpio’s role in shaping Port Charles during some of its most iconic years. For fans who grew up watching his adventures and relationships, this moment promises long-awaited emotional resolution.
